Historical Encounters & Patterns

The last 11 meetings between Novara and Pergolettese reveal a tightly contested rivalry, with 3 wins apiece and 5 draws, averaging just over 2 goals per game (2.36). A consistent trend emerges: both sides are capable of scoring, with a notable 64% BTTS rate in these fixtures. Recent encounters have seen scores like 2-2, 2-1, and 1-1, underscoring the unpredictability and the potential for goals from both teams.
